"Carowinds lays off 20 full-time workers
Paramount's Carowinds amusement park has laid off 20 full-time workers as part of a long-term business plan, park officials say.
The layoffs, which took effect last week, were a management decision and not the result of a business slowdown or a weak economy, said Carowinds spokesman Scott Anderson.
The 105-acre theme and water park now employs about 125 people full time, and between 1,700 and 2,200 seasonal workers.
The cuts marked one of the biggest full-time work force reductions in the past six or seven years at Carowinds, Anderson said.
The layoffs will help the company focus on front-line employees -- those who deal with guests.
Carowinds employees are considered North Carolina workers because the amusement park's business offices are in North Carolina."
